Output f2e130996626b963582d5da58c044c39301e629f320d3c01eba735ac9d2476e0:0

value
142668706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d9a57a70b95105e7a48af7a45da3030b6cb29c0 OP_EQUALVERIFY OP_CHECKSIG
address
1JHXc9u1xkRz9BsUF8zjoc19z5kJKyaUa8
transaction
f2e130996626b963582d5da58c044c39301e629f320d3c01eba735ac9d2476e0
spent
true